The town of Villa las Rosas is located in the Municipality of Tapachula (in the State of Chiapas). There are 401 inhabitants. In the list of the most populated towns of the whole municipality, it is the number #91 of the ranking. Villa las Rosas is at 56 meters of altitude.

You can find it at 9.6 kilometers, in direction Northwest, from the town of Tapachula de Córdova y Ordóñez, which has the largest population within the municipality.
